快速自动增益控制技术研究

摘    要:在光电干扰环境中,红外干扰弹辐射能量变化剧烈,抗干扰红外导引头要求实时表征红外干扰弹辐射能量动态变化,以满足幅度鉴别和幅度相关的需要。主放对自动增益控制快速性要求很高。文章介绍了前馈快速自动增益控制电路、计算机增益控制电路工作原理的性能,并对几种自动增益电路性能进行了对比。

STUDY ON FAST AGC TECHNIQUE

Abstract:In electro-optical countermeasure environment, the variation of radiant energy of IR flare is very acute. The ant jamming IR seeker demands the dynamitic change of radiant energy of IR flare to be reflected in real time to meet the requirements of amplitude discrimination and amplitude correlation. The main amplifier demands a high rapidity in AGC. It is introduced that the principle and peffermance of the fast feedward AGC circuit and the computer gain control circuit in this paper. The characteristics of several AGC circuits are also compared.
